The Cheatham Lock and Dam is a dam in
Ashland City, Tennessee Ashland City is a town and the county seat of Cheatham County, Tennessee. Located in Middle Tennessee, it is part of the Nashville-Davidson– Murfreesboro– Franklin, TN Metropolitan Statistical Area. As of the 2020 census, the town's popula ...
, USA. It was built on the
Cumberland River The Cumberland River is a major waterway of the Southern United States. The U.S. Geological Survey. National Hydrography Dataset high-resolution flowline dataThe National Map, accessed June 8, 2011 river drains almost of southern Kentucky and ...
from 1949 to 1951. Electricity from the dam is marketed by the
Southeastern Power Administration The Southeastern Power Administration is a United States Power Marketing Administration with responsibility for marketing hydroelectric power from 22 water projects operated by the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ers in the states of West Virginia, Virg ...
.
